CVE-2025-24869: Information Disclosure vulnerability in SAP NetWeaver Application Server Java

First published: Tue Feb 11 2025(Updated: )

SAP NetWeaver Application Server Java allows an attacker to access an endpoint that can disclose information about deployed server components, including their XML definitions. This information should ideally be restricted to customer administrators, even though they may not need it. These XML files are not entirely SAP-internal as they are deployed with the server. In such a scenario, sensitive information could be exposed without compromising its integrity or availability.
